Stephanie generously sent some Earth Mama Angel Baby bath products for my kiddos to use. Angel Baby is the only complete line of all natural and USDA certified organic herbal baby care products and all products are phthalate-free, toxin-free, cruelty free and vegan, with no artificial preservatives, dyes or fragrances. We received the Angel Baby Shampoo and Body Wash, Lotion and Diaper Rash Soap.
What I noticed immediately upon use was the smell of the Angel Baby products; a very subtle and sweet smell that reminds me of chamomile tea. It’s such a nice change of pace from typical baby smelling products that I often find overbearing. The Shampoo and Body Wash dispenses in a foam which I find to be super easy to use. I can squirt some on Baby Girl, put the bottle down and not worry about it running or being wastefully dripped all over the tub. It worked great as a shampoo and even left Toddler Boy’s crazy long curls conditioned and easy to comb. I love using the Lotion to massage Baby Girl after her bath. It is smooth, not at all greasy and very light. The best surprise of the bunch was the Diaper Rash Soap – who knew such a thing existed? “Angel Baby Diaper Rash Soap is like Bottom Balm in a bar! This diaper rash and first aid soap is tough on diaper rash but gentle and mild on tender little bottoms.” So cool!
